TechTorch

Location:HOME > Technology > content

Technology

Epic Games and C Programming: Do You Need a Degree to Work There?

March 05, 2025Technology2860
Epic Games and C Programming: Do You Need a Degree to Work There? The

Epic Games and C Programming: Do You Need a Degree to Work There?

The question often arises: do you need a degree specifically in C to work at Epic Games or in a C programming role? The common misconception is that a formal education in C is required. However, the reality is quite different. While a degree in computer science, software engineering, or related fields can be beneficial, it is not the only path to success at Epic Games.

Are Formal Academic Programs Necessary?

At Epic Games, the emphasis is placed on practical skills and demonstrated proficiency rather than a specific degree. According to industry experts, a degree in computer science or software engineering can be advantageous, but it is not a strict requirement. The company values skills and experience, particularly in C programming, more than an academic degree.

Many professionals have successfully landed jobs at Epic Games without holding a specific degree in C or related fields. Rather, they have shown their ability to work with C, contribute to game development projects, and understand the complexities of the field. Practical experience, a strong portfolio, and a solid grasp of C programming are often more important than a degree.

Willingness to Work Long Hours and Low Pay

The perception that long hours and low pay are the primary qualifications is a common complaint. It’s true that the industry can be demanding, and Epic Games is no exception. However, the work-life balance is not a primary focus for everyone. For those who are willing to dedicate significant time and effort to their craft, there are opportunities for growth and success.

Nonetheless, it is important to consider the work-life balance when pursuing a career at Epic Games or any other tech company. If work-life balance is a crucial factor for you, it is worth exploring other opportunities where this aspect may be more prioritized.

No University Offers a C Degree, But a CS Degree Might Help

It is a common misconception that universities offer a specific degree in C. Typically, universities offer degrees in computer science, software engineering, or related fields, which often include coursework in C programming. While there is no C-specific degree, acquiring a CS degree can still be beneficial.

A CS degree provides a solid foundation in programming principles and can enhance your understanding of software engineering. Additionally, a degree in CS can open doors to various job opportunities and long-term career growth within the industry.

Practical Experience and Portfolio Importance

At Epic Games, practical experience and a strong portfolio are highly valued. Contributing to game development projects, participating in open-source projects, or building your own games can significantly enhance your resume. These experiences not only showcase your skills but also demonstrate your commitment to the field.

When applying for a C programming role at Epic Games, it is crucial to highlight your relevant projects and experiences. This can include:

Contributions to open-source projects Game development projects you have worked on Personal coding projects in C

A well-constructed portfolio that demonstrates your technical skills and understanding of C programming can make a significant difference in your application process.

Conclusion

In conclusion, while a degree in computer science or software engineering can provide a valuable foundation, it is not a necessity to work at Epic Games or in a C programming role. Practical experience, proficiency in C, and a strong portfolio are often more important. If you are passionate about game development and skilled in C programming, Epic Games may offer you the opportunity to pursue your career goals.

Remember, the technology industry values skills and experience over a specific degree. Always focus on demonstrating your abilities and putting your best work forward to secure a position at Epic Games or any other tech company that aligns with your career aspirations.